﻿/*禁止打印*/
@media print{
	body{display:none}
} 

html,body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,fieldset,input,blockquote,th,td{font:12px 宋体;line-height:122%;margin:0;padding:0;}
img,body,html{border:0;}
ol,ul{list-style:none;}
caption,th{text-align:left;}
h1,h2,h3,h4,h5,h6{font-size:100%;}
body{font:"宋体" 12px verdana,arial,tahoma;}
html,body{border:0 none;margin:0;padding:0;}
#loadingTab{position:absolute;left:38%;top:40%;z-index:20001;height:auto;width:300px;padding:2px;}
#loadingTab a:hover{color:#990;text-decoration:underline;}
#loadingTab .loading-indicator{background:#FFF;color:#444;font:bold 15px tahoma,arial,helvetica;height:auto;margin:0;padding:10px;}
#loadingTab a{font:"宋体";font-size:12px;color:#000;text-decoration:none;}
#loading-msg{font:"宋体",normal;font-size:12px;}

/*设置头部的工具条的颜色*/
.docs-header .x-panel-body {background:transparent;}
.docs-header .x-toolbar {background:transparent;}
.top-toolbar{border:0 none;background:transparent;}

/*设置皮肤的高度*/
.docs-header .x-color-palette{height:34px;}

/*修改导航树的高度*/
.custom-lineheight .x-tree-node-el{height:23px;line-height:23px;padding-top:3px;}

.homeicon{background-image:url(../../Images/icons/indexicon.gif)!important;}

/*每个模块的ICon*/
.SimulationExamSmallIcon{/*模拟考试*/
	background-image:url(../Images/Icon/SimulationExam.png) !important;
	background-repeat:no-repeat;
}
.oneByoneSmallIcon{/*逐题练习*/
	background-image:url(../Images/Icon/OneByOne.png) !important;
	background-repeat:no-repeat;
}
.favoriteSmallIcon{/*收藏试题*/
	background-image:url(../Images/Icon/favorite.png) !important;
	background-repeat:no-repeat;
}
.selectProblemSmallIcon{/*选题练习*/
	background-image:url(../Images/Icon/SelectProblem.png) !important;
	background-repeat:no-repeat;
}
.practiceDiarySmallIcon{/*练习记录*/
	background-image:url(../Images/Icon/PracticeDiary.png) !important;
	background-repeat:no-repeat;
}
.reDoErrProblemSmallIcon{/*错题重做*/
	background-image:url(../Images/Icon/ErrProblem.png) !important;
	background-repeat:no-repeat;
}
.statisticsSmallIcon{/*统计分析*/
	background-image:url(../Images/Icon/Statistics.png) !important;
	background-repeat:no-repeat;
}
.testGenIcon{/*我的考试*/
	background-image:url(../Images/Icon/NatureTestGen16.gif) !important;
	background-repeat:no-repeat;
}
.subjectCourseIcon{/*选课中心*/
	background-image:url(../Images/Icon/subjectCourseIcon.gif) !important;
	background-repeat:no-repeat;
}
/*修改密码*/
.editPwdIconMenu{background:url(../Images/Icon/key.png) no-repeat !important;}
/*修改资料*/
.editUserInfoicon{background-image:url(../Images/Icon/setuseridicon.png)!important;}

/*练习记录tbar icon*/
.playIcon{
	background-image:url(../images/studentcenter.png) !important;
	background-repeat:no-repeat;
	background-position:-49px 0px !important;
}
.stopIcon{
	background-image:url(../Images/studentcenter.png) !important;
	background-repeat:no-repeat;
	background-position:-49px -48px !important;

}
.pauseIcon{
	background-image:url(../Images/studentcenter.png) !important;
	background-repeat:no-repeat;
	background-position:-49px -24px !important;
}


/*设置button按钮始终处于鼠标移上去的状态*/
.personal-btn-over .x-btn-left{background:url(../Ext/resources/images/default/toolbar/tb-btn-sprite.gif) no-repeat 0 0;}
.personal-btn-over .x-btn-right{background:url(../Ext/resources/images/default/toolbar/tb-btn-sprite.gif) no-repeat 0 -21px;}
.personal-btn-over .x-btn-center{background:url(../Ext/resources/images/default/toolbar/tb-btn-sprite.gif) repeat-x 0 -42px;}




/*试卷排版dataview css 样式*/
.testCourseName{
	text-align:center;
	font-size:15px;
	font-weight:600;
	height:20px;
	overflow:hidden;
}
.group-item{
	padding:10px;
	margin:0;
}
.group-itemeven{
	padding:10px;
	margin:0;
	background:#F4EEEE;
	border:1px solid #ccc;
}
.group-itemodd{
	padding:10px;
	margin:0;
	background:#EEF4FC;
	border:1px solid #ccc;
}
.partitionTitle{
	margin:0 0 10px 0;
	font-family:微软雅黑, 黑体, Arial Black;
	font-size:16px;
	font-weight:700;
	*height:100%;/*ie6*/
	border-bottom:1px solid #cccccc;
}
.answerButtons{
	clear:both;
	margin-top:5px;
	text-align:right;
	color:#1F3A87;
}
.problemAnswerDetails{
	clear:both;
	padding:3px;
	*height:100%;/*ie6*/
	border:1px solid #cccccc;
}
.problemKey{
	font-size:13px;
	line-height:22px;
}
.dottedLine{
	clear:both;
	height:1px;
	overflow:hidden;
	background:url(../Images/dottedLine.gif) repeat-x;
	margin:5px 0 10px 0;
}

.problem-item{
	clear:both;
	font-size:16px;
	line-height:26px;
	font-family:Arial,微软雅黑;
}
.problem-num
{
	padding:3px;
	font-size:20px;
	font-weight :bolder;
	font-family :Sans-Serif;
	color:#000099;
	background-color:#AADDFF;
}
.problem-mark
{
color :Gray;
}
/*题干*/
.problem-main
{
	color:#222299;
}
.option-item
{
}
/*备选项*/
.option-item :hover{
	/*clear:both;*/
	#border:1px solid #98CD9D;
	color:#F97D62;
	font-weight:bolder;
}
/*当前题目背景色*/
.current{
	#border:1px solid #99BBE8;
	background-color:#CCEECC;
}
.btn
{
	text-indent:20px;
	cursor:pointer;
}
.icon-favorite
{
	width :16px;
	height:16px;
	background:url(../images/studentcenter.png) no-repeat 0 -225px;
	vertical-align: -3px;
	display:inline-block;
}
.icon-answer
{
	width :16px;
	height:16px;
	background:url(../images/studentcenter.png) no-repeat 0 -25px;
	vertical-align: -3px;
	display:inline-block;
}
.icon-comment
{
	width :16px;
	height:16px;
	background:url(../images/studentcenter.png) no-repeat 0 -125px;
	vertical-align: -3px;
	display:inline-block;
}
.btn-showanswer
{
	background:url(../Images/dottedLine.gif);
	
}
/*章节练习永远不删除，会造成ID重复 dateViewIDType用来区分ID*/
.problem-item_other_{
	clear:both;
	font-size:14px;
	line-height:18px;
}
.hSplit{
	padding:0;
	margin:0;
	height:10px;
	overflow:hidden;
}
/*标记题目的下来menu*/
#markProblemMenu{
	padding-top:3px;
	list-style-type:none;
}
#markProblemMenu li{
	height:20px;
	overflow:hidden;
	line-height:20px;
}
#markProblemMenu li .img { 
	float:left;
	height:20px;
	overflow:hidden;
	/*vertical-align:middle; */
}
#markProblemMenu li .text { 
	float:left;
	height:20px;
	overflow:hidden;
	cursor:pointer;
}
/*试卷排版dataview css 样式*/


/*column-tree*/
.x-column-tree .x-tree-node {
    zoom:1;
}
.x-column-tree .x-tree-node-el {
    /*border-bottom:1px solid #eee; borders? */
    zoom:1;
}
.x-column-tree .x-tree-selected {
    background: #d9e8fb;
}
.x-column-tree  .x-tree-node a {
    line-height:18px;
    vertical-align:middle;
}
.x-column-tree  .x-tree-node a span{
	
}
.x-column-tree  .x-tree-node .x-tree-selected a span{
	background:transparent;
	color:#000;
}
.x-tree-col {
    float:left;
    overflow:hidden;
    padding:0 1px;
    zoom:1;
}

.x-tree-col-text, .x-tree-hd-text {
    overflow:hidden;
    -o-text-overflow: ellipsis;
	text-overflow: ellipsis;
    padding:3px 3px 3px 5px;
    white-space: nowrap;
	height:1.2em;//height:20px;
    font:normal 11px arial, tahoma, helvetica, sans-serif;
}
.x-tree-hd-text {
	height:1.3em;//height:20px;
}

.x-tree-headers {
    background: #f9f9f9 url(../../Images/treeicon/grid3-hrow.gif) repeat-x 0 bottom;
	cursor:default;
    zoom:1;
}

.x-tree-hd {
    float:left;
    overflow:hidden;
    border-left:1px solid #eee;
    border-right:1px solid #d0d0d0;
}

.x-grid3-check-col-halfon{width:100%;height:16px;background-position:center center;background-repeat:no-repeat;background-color:transparent;background-image:url(../../images/treeicon/halfChecked.gif);}
/*column-tree*/

 /*模拟考试中的设置题目个数的EditGrid的row的颜色*/
.SimulationExamGrid .x-grid3-cell-inner{
	background-color:#F5F6F8;
}

/*设置button按钮始终处于鼠标移上去的状态*/
.personal-btn-over .x-btn-left{background:url(../../Ext/resources/images/default/toolbar/tb-btn-sprite.gif) no-repeat 0 0;}
.personal-btn-over .x-btn-right{background:url(../../Ext/resources/images/default/toolbar/tb-btn-sprite.gif) no-repeat 0 -21px;}
.personal-btn-over .x-btn-center{background:url(../../Ext/resources/images/default/toolbar/tb-btn-sprite.gif) repeat-x 0 -42px;}
.personal-btn-over .x-btn-text{color:#2B4E76;}


/*LockingGrid*/
.x-grid3-viewport, .x-grid3-locked{
	overflow:hidden;
	position:absolute;
}
.x-grid3-locked .x-grid3-scroller{
	overflow:hidden;
	border-right: 1px solid #99BBE8;
}
.x-grid3-scroll-spacer {
	height: 19px;
}
.x-lockinggrid-lefcolbg{
 	background-color:#F5F6F8;
}
/*LockingGrid*/

/*LockingGridSummary*/
.x-grid3-summary-row {
    border-left:1px solid #fff;
    border-right:1px solid #EDEDED;
    color:#333;
	overflow:hidden;
    background: #f1f2f4;
}
.x-grid3-summary-row .x-grid3-cell-inner {
    font-weight:bold;
    padding-bottom:4px;
}
.x-grid3-cell-first .x-grid3-cell-inner {
    
}
.x-grid-hide-summary .x-grid3-summary-row {
    display:none;
}
.x-grid3-summary-msg {
    padding:4px 16px;
    font-weight:bold;
}
.x-grid3-gridsummary-row-inner{overflow:hidden;width:100%;}/* IE6 requires width:100% for hori. scroll to work */
.x-grid3-gridsummary-row-offset{width:10000px;}
.x-grid-hide-gridsummary .x-grid3-gridsummary-row-inner{display:none;}
/*LockingGridSummary*/

/*试题评价*/
.Dafen {width:110px; cursor:pointer;}
.Dafen span {background:url(../images/newstar.gif) center -1px no-repeat;line-height:18px;padding:0 8px 0 8px;}
.Dafen textarea{
	font-family:"宋体";
	font-size:12px;
	border:1px solid #7F9DB9;
}

/*评价搜索icon*/
.searchEvaluationIcon{
	background:url(../../images/icons/search.png) no-repeat 0 3px !important;
}
/*试题评价*/


 .UploaPicIconCls{background-image:url(../Images/uploadimage.png)!important;}